Hi guys. I have just bought a 2007 suzuki rmz 450. Never had a dirt bike before always owned super bikes. Any hints tips etc with owning maintaining riding etc 📎ImageUploadedByThumper Talk1395342537.302190.jpg

That's not an 07 man, that's an 05-06 model you have. They are great bikes, my bike I've been posting is an 05 & I also own an 07. I'd suggest getting it ported & if the exhaust is stock you definately want to change that too, they're too restrictive. & maintainence wise. Check the timing chain often because they tend to get loose after awhile but other than that they are great bikes!

Thanks. Here in South Africa they registered as 07 models. Thanks for the tips. Only problem is performance parts are so expensive with the weak rand etc. I heard that there is a exzorst mod by trimming a few centimeters off the silencer. Are the black rims standard on these bikes. How can I tell if the cam chain needs tightening etc

Id atleast take the silencer out, it'll help to a certain extent. Black wheels are not standard, silver excel wheels are stock but they could be painted. & when the cam chain is loose you will hear a difference when it's idling (somewhat of a knocking sound) people often assume it's the valves but it's not. That's how I got mine so cheap, the guy thought the valves was bad & was gonna pass it along before things started breaking. But he was wrong & took me 10 minutes to correct. I did eventually adjust the valves & port the head & it runs strong
